Amazon CloudFront is a web service that speeds up the distribution of static and dynamic web content, such as HTML, CSS, JavaScript, and images. It works by caching copies of content at "edge locations" around the world. When you visit a website that uses CloudFront, your request is routed to the nearest edge location to ensure the fastest possible loading speed. dnrweqffuwjtx cloudfrontnet

CloudFront generates unique subdomain prefixes for each distribution to ensure global uniqueness and simplify routing. For a developer, this means no need to purchase a custom domain during testing. For a small business, it offers immediate go-to-market speed. These URLs are predictable in structure but unpredictable in value — they are functional placeholders. – CloudFront presents a certificate for *.cloudfront.net . This wildcard certificate is issued by Amazon, covering all distribution subdomains. The client validates the certificate chain.
